I am trying to create a visualization of which employees are friends with each other. I am trying to create a visualization out of our internal social network. Something like Nexus facebook app did back in 2007.

I think nexus used python and javascript to achieve this. Me a php & javascript noob. I appreciate if any anybody can share libraries that can used to achieve this.
